Tron Foster the more the tail bends at a 90 degree choppier it is Less of a bend makes it wide glide on straight retrieve like a big s.. the chopp glides you mainly work them with the reel with 1/2 turn retrieves like a pause and go.. or you can use them like a jerk bait with jerks to make them chop

Yea seems to be more of a swaver style of glide great for covering water in open flats .. like the arashi glide.. I modified my swavers with a dremel to chop more.. the choppier style of glides are better around cover..

I have yet to see any scientific documentation on the red eyes and any correlation to the spawn.. I have read it’s just a pigmentation issue.. I have caught several hundreds of bass during the spawn and only like 2-5% of them have red eyes.. I would like to see some actual resources to determine if this is a real occurrence.. or just a genetic mutation.. there are a lot of myths on this such as chemicals in water from runoff to levels of mercury
